Audi e-tron will launch in two variants: e-tron 50 and e-tron 55
17
VIEWS
Share on WhatsappShare on FacebookShare on Twitter

Audi, the German luxury car manufacturer, is set to start its electric journey in India with the launch of the Audi e-tron on July 22, 2021. To give customers the widest range within the luxury EV segment, Audi India will offer the Audi e-tron in two body styles – Audi e-tron and Audi e-tron Sportback. Audi e-tron buyers will further have the choice of the Audi e-tron 50 and Audi e-tron 55. The Audi e-tron Sportback will be available in the e-tron 55 variant.

The Audi e-tron is not just an SUV but is the umbrella brand for all Audi electric vehicles sold. The Audi e-tron 55 and the Audi e-tron Sportback 55 draw power from a 95kW battery and have a range of 359-484 km (WLTP combined). Both these cars boast of 300 kW of power and 664 Nm of torque. The Audi e-tron 50 draws power from a 71kW battery and has a range of 264-379 km (WLTP combined). The Audi e-tron 50 boasts of 230 kW of power and 540 Nm of torque.

Highlights

  • Luxury of choice – 3 Audi e-trons to choose from 
  • The Audi e-tron will be launched in two variants: Audi e-tron 50 and the Audi e-tron 55
  • The aerodynamic Audi e-tron Sportback 55, with its curvaceous coupe-like rear, will have one variant 
  • The Audi e-tron 55, along with the Audi e-tron Sportback 55, boast of 300 kW of power and 664 Nm of torque
  • The Audi e-tron 50 boasts of 230 kW of power and 540 Nm of torque 
  • quattro permanent all-wheel drive, Progressive Steering, Adaptive Air Suspension, 4 Zone Air Conditioner and Matrix LED Headlamps offered as standard
  • 11kW AC Home Charger and capable of upto 150 kW DC Charging
  • Launch on July 22, 2021
